M83 Announce New Singer/Keyboardist Kaela Sinclair, Resulting From Open Call Auditions

Mar 04, 2016 M83

M83 (aka Anthony Gonzalez and collaborators) recently held an open call audition for a new female keyboardist/singer to fill the spot vacated by Morgan Kibby, who left the lineup to more fully focus on her White Sea solo project. More

Majical Cloudz Split Up, Announce Final Show

Mar 04, 2016 Majical Cloudz

The end is here for Majical Cloudz, the duo (Devon Welsh and Matt Otto) have announced via a post on their Tumblr account that they are breaking up. The band will play one final show, on March 11 at La Sala Rossa in their hometown of Montreal, performing an extra long set with no opening act. More

Kristin Kontrol (Dee Dee of Dum Dum Girls) Announces Album, Shares “X-Communicate”

Mar 03, 2016 Kristin Kontrol

Dum Dum Girls frontwoman/main creative force Dee Dee Penny (sometimes just known as Dee Dee) recently announced a new solo project called Kristin Kontrol. Dee Dee’s real name is Kristin Welchez, hence the name of her new project. Now Kristin Kontrol has announced a debut album, X-Communicate, and shared its title track, which you can listen to below. The album is due out May 27 via Sub Pop (also Dum Dum Girls’ label). More

Elliott Smith Tribute Album to Feature Julien Baker, Amanda Palmer, Jesu/Sun Kil Moon, and Yuck

Mar 03, 2016 J Mascis

American Laundromat Records have announced Say Yes! A Tribute to Elliott Smith, which is due out October 15. The Elliott Smith tribute album will feature newly recorded covers of Smith’s songs by Julien Baker, Amanda Palmer, Jesu/Sun Kil Moon, Yuck, Waxahatchee, Lou Barlow, J Mascis, Adam Franklin of Swervedriver, Tanya Donelly, and others.
